چکیده مقاله:

Melon (Cucumis melo L.) is an important popular high-consumption product in the world. Melon Fusarium wilt (Fusarium oxysporum f.sp. melonis: FOM) is a global destructive disease. In this research, ۸ melon landraces from Esfahan area with Isabelle and Charentais-T as control genotypes resistant and susceptible, respectively, on completely random block design with three replications and five plants in each replication challenged with ۱.۲ race of F. oxysporum by artificial inoculation. Seedlings were inoculated with a suspension of ۱۰۶ spores/ml at the first true leaf stage. The disease severity index (DSI) was assessed on leaves using a rating scale from ۱ to ۵. Based on the results of means comparisons, DSI value for Isabelle genotype and Zarde shotori were as the most resistant genotype. Habib Abad, Lateefeh Gorgab, Garmak, Barg ney, Shahabadi, Firoozan and Tosrokh genotypes were the most susceptible genotypes against Fom۱.۲ even more than the susceptible control cultivar (Charentais -T).
